PAT 7960 Primary Care Rotation I - Spring 2014       3-3 hrs.

Prerequisites: Successful completion of Year I PA courses with a 3.00 GPA, and/or permission of the program director. A four-week rotation in which Physician Assistant students are assigned to an active primary care physician practitioner, or a rural primary care facility. The student will learn all aspects of the care of specific patients with exposure to various in-house services, out-patient clinics and nursing homes.
